Charlotte-Mecklenburg Schools students begin return to in-person learning CMS parents, students prepare for return to in-person learning By Brandon Hamilton | February 14, 2021 at 9:50 PM EST - Updated February 15 at 8:01 AM CHARLOTTE, N.C. (WBTV) - For the first time in weeks, students in Charlotte-Mecklenburg Schools returned to the classroom for in-person learning Monday. Pre-K, elementary including K-8 and students with disabilities approved through the Individualized Education Program (IEP) are returning. Welcome back to in-person learning, CMS family! We are excited and our buses are ready. CMS set up a “symptom screener” system to help reduce the chances of COVID-19 spread. Each morning, a CMS Symptom Screener will come to CMS student email addresses with a link to complete the survey. The link can also be accessed here.
